Design and Fabrication of MMIC Coupled Lines Coupler Consisting of Composite Right/Left-Handed Transmission Lines
Coupled-line directional coupler based on CRLH (Composite Right/Left-Handed) cascaded structures is designed, analyzed and then fabricated. The technological realization of the coupler involves one mask process on silicon substrate, using CPWs (CoPlanar Waveguides). The preliminary measurements were also performed, showing that the experimental results fit well the simulation results.
